Understanding Digital Signatures

At the core, a digital signature is a mathematical scheme for verifying the authenticity and integrity of a message, software, or digital document. Unlike traditional handwritten signatures, digital signatures utilize cryptographic techniques that provide a higher level of security and are legally recognized in many jurisdictions.

When you sign a document digitally, a unique code generated by a hash function is created, which is then encrypted with the signer’s private key. This process ensures that only the signer can create a valid signature for that document, thus proving both identity and integrity.

The Legal Standing of Digital Signatures

Digital signatures aren’t just a tech fad; they hold significant legal weight. Many countries, including the United States, have enacted laws that recognize the validity of digital signatures. The Electronic Signatures in Global and National Commerce (ESIGN) Act and the Uniform Electronic Transactions Act (UETA) are two major legislations in the U.S. that establish the legal standing of electronic signatures.

However, it’s essential to ensure that the digital signature method you choose complies with local laws. Always check the regulations applicable to your jurisdiction, as requirements can vary widely.

Common Misconceptions About Digital Signatures

Despite their growing popularity, several misconceptions still cloud the understanding of digital signatures. Let’s tackle a few:

First, many believe that digital signatures are the same as electronic signatures. While all digital signatures are electronic signatures, not all electronic signatures are digital. Digital signatures use cryptography for enhanced security, whereas electronic signatures can be as simple as a scanned handwritten signature.

Another common myth is that digital signatures are less secure than traditional signatures. In reality, they offer superior protection. The cryptographic processes involved make it extremely difficult to forge or alter a digitally signed document without detection.
